A holistic planner is an organizational tool designed to integrate personal, professional, emotional, and physical goals within a single system. Unlike traditional planners that simply list daily tasks or appointments, holistic planners encourage users to reflect on all areas of life. For example, a holistic planner might include spaces for career objectives, health routines, relationship milestones, and personal growth targets.
This approach helps users maintain perspective, ensuring that no important life domain is neglected. For a detailed overview of these core ideas, see Holistic planning fundamentals.
The foundation of holistic planners lies in balance and alignment. These planners emphasize equal attention to work, health, relationships, and self-care. By aligning daily actions with personal values and long-term vision, holistic planners help users create a life that feels both productive and meaningful.
Another key principle is adaptability. Holistic planners are designed to be flexible, allowing users to adjust goals and routines as circumstances change. This supports continuous growth and resilience, even when life takes unexpected turns.

Choosing between digital and paper holistic planners depends on your lifestyle and preferences. Digital planners offer portability, automation, and easy syncing with your devices. They excel at integrating reminders, analytics, and habit tracking.
Paper planners provide a tactile experience, encouraging mindfulness and creativity. Many users find that writing by hand helps with memory retention and reflection. However, paper planners may lack the versatility and instant access of digital tools.
A recent survey found that 54% of users prefer hybrid planner solutions, combining the strengths of both formats. Consider your daily routines and decide which style of holistic planners will keep you engaged and consistent.

With your vision defined, use your holistic planners to break large ambitions into S.M.A.R.T. goals—Specific, Measurable, Achievable, Relevant, and Time-bound. These planners typically provide templates or prompts for goal-setting across multiple domains.
Begin by identifying one goal per domain: career, health, relationships, and finances. Use checklists or tables to outline steps, deadlines, and milestones.
